The Sydney Morning Herald interviews Ty Segall
http://www.smh.com.au/entertainment/music/ty-segall-a-man-with-boyish-charm-20140904-10bh7a.html

The last time Ty Segall played his former hometown of San Francisco in 2013, the garage rock graduate found himself in the dressing room of the storied Fillmore. Headlining the auditorium that had once played host to the likes of The Velvet Underground and Nico, The Grateful Dead, and Pink Floyd, Segall had to admit that his adventures in music, often potent but always prolific, had become an actual career…
